Migration 1.5 - Debian 8.10

Fragen zum WAPT-Server / Anfragen und Hilfe im Zusammenhang mit dem WAPT-Server
Forumregeln
Community-Forumregeln
* Englischer Support auf www.reddit.com/r/wapt
* Französischer Community-Support ist in diesem Forum verfügbar.
* Bitte kennzeichnen Sie gelöste Themen mit [GELÖST].
* Bitte bearbeiten Sie keine Themen, die mit [GELÖST] markiert sind. Erstellen Sie stattdessen ein neues Thema und verweisen Sie auf das alte.
* Geben Sie die installierte WAPT-Version, die vollständige Versionsnummer und die Build-Nummer (2.2.1.11957 / 2.2.2.12337 / usw.) sowie die Enterprise-/Discovery-Edition an.
* Versionen 1.8.2 und älter werden nicht mehr unterstützt. Fragen zu Version 1.8.2 werden nur beantwortet, wenn sie sich auf ein Upgrade auf eine unterstützte Version (2.1, 2.2 usw.) beziehen.
* Geben Sie das Server-Betriebssystem (Linux/Windows) und die Version (Debian Buster/Bullseye – CentOS 7 – Windows Server 2012/2016/2019) an.
* Geben Sie gegebenenfalls das Betriebssystem des Administrations-/Paketerstellungsrechners und des Rechners mit dem problematischen Agenten an (Windows 7/10/11/Debian 11/etc.).
* Vermeiden Sie es, mehrere Fragen in einem Thema zu stellen, da diese sonst möglicherweise ignoriert werden. Falls mehrere Themen relevant sind, erstellen Sie bitte separate Themen, vorzugsweise nacheinander und nicht gleichzeitig (d. h. vermeiden Sie Spam im Forum).
* Fügen Sie Code-Snippets, Screenshots und andere Bilder direkt in Ihren Beitrag ein. Links zu Pastebin, Bitly und anderen Drittanbieterseiten werden systematisch entfernt.
* Wie in jedem Community-Forum erfolgt die Unterstützung freiwillig durch die Mitglieder. Für kommerziellen Support kontaktieren Sie bitte den Vertrieb von Tranquil IT unter +44 2 40 97 57 55.
Gesperrt
Stenon
Nachrichten: 36
Anmeldung: 2. Juni 2016 - 8:04 Uhr

20. März 2018 - 06:17 Uhr

Hallo,

gestern habe ich voller Vorfreude mit der Migration von Version 1.3 auf 1.5 begonnen.

Ich bin Ihrer Dokumentation (Debian) gefolgt und hänge an zwei Punkten fest:
– In der WaptConsole werden mir außer meinem eigenen PC keine Clients mehr angezeigt. Das Ergebnis des Skripts migrate-hosts.py sieht etwa so aus: skip pc01 skip pc02
– In der WaptConsole kann ich, auch auf meinem eigenen PC, keine Updates starten (die Optionen „Nach Updates suchen“ und „Upgrades anwenden“ sind ausgegraut).

Vielen Dank.
Benutzeravatar
Sfonteneau
WAPT-Experte
Nachrichten: 2322
Registriert: 10. Juli 2014 - 23:52 Uhr
Kontakt:

20. März 2018 - 08:39 Uhr

Das Skript migrate-host migriert keine Maschinen, sondern benennt Maschinenpakete anhand der UUID mit einem FQDN-Namen um:

https://www.wapt.fr/fr/doc/changelog.ht ... erneut global

Sie können einen Neustart versuchen:

Code: Alle auswählen

sudo -u wapt PYTHONPATH=/opt/wapt PYTHONHOME=/opt/wapt /opt/wapt/bin/python /opt/wapt/waptserver/waptserver_upgrade.py upgrade2postgres -c "/opt/wapt/conf/waptserver.ini"
Stenon
Nachrichten: 36
Anmeldung: 2. Juni 2016 - 8:04 Uhr

20. März 2018 - 09:12 Uhr

Vielen Dank für die schnelle Antwort.
Ich habe den Befehl ausprobiert, aber er hat nicht funktioniert:

Code: Alle auswählen

sudo -u wapt PYTHONPATH=/opt/wapt PYTHONHOME=/opt/wapt /opt/wapt/bin/python /opt/wapt/waptserver/waptserver_upgrade.py upgrade2postgres -c "/opt/wapt/conf/waptserver.ini"

Code: Alle auswählen

sudo -u wapt PYTHONPATH=/opt/wapt PYTHONHOME=/opt/wapt /opt/wapt/bin/python /opt/wapt/waptserver/waptserver_upgrade.py upgrade2postgres -c "/opt/wapt/conf/waptserver.ini"

Code: Alle auswählen

Upgrading from mongodb to postgres
[uwsgi]
http-socket = 127.0.0.1:8080
master = true
processes = 16
wsgi = waptserver:app
chdir = /opt/wapt/waptserver/
max-requests = 100
uid = wapt
gid = www-data
enable-threads = true

[options]
wapt_user = admin
wapt_password = 729593ef2b450ae2937f1d7dd4875c58cb6816a3
wapt_folder = /var/www/wapt
server_uuid = 4e0399fa-391c-11e6-a99f-00505690d75f
waptwua_folder = /var/www/waptwua
allow_unauthenticated_registration = True
secret_key = HjNzkazXLePXsEgYcjDxNflnkgpTrx8qPV5PD1eWDwTXZAHIqhCGnGc37C465YDY


dumping mongodb data
ERROR: option '--db' cannot be specified more than once

DANKE !
Benutzeravatar
Sfonteneau
WAPT-Experte
Nachrichten: 2322
Registriert: 10. Juli 2014 - 23:52 Uhr
Kontakt:

20. März 2018 - 09:45 Uhr

Können Sie angeben, ob die Bestellung

Code: Alle auswählen

mongoexport  -c hosts --jsonArray --db wapt
Funktioniert es?
Stenon
Nachrichten: 36
Anmeldung: 2. Juni 2016 - 8:04 Uhr

20. März 2018 - 10:16 Uhr

Ja, ich habe es ausprobiert und am Ende wird Folgendes angezeigt:
124 Datensätze exportiert
...
Benutzeravatar
Sfonteneau
WAPT-Experte
Nachrichten: 2322
Registriert: 10. Juli 2014 - 23:52 Uhr
Kontakt:

20. März 2018 - 10:22 Uhr

Es liegt also wahrscheinlich ein Fehler in der Nachkonfiguration vor; könnten Sie Folgendes ersetzen:

Code: Alle auswählen

data = subprocess.check_output('mongoexport -d wapt -c hosts --jsonArray --db wapt',shell=True)

Code: Alle auswählen

data = subprocess.check_output('mongoexport -c hosts --jsonArray --db wapt',shell=True)
In

Code: Alle auswählen

/opt/wapt/waptserver/waptserver_upgrade.py
Stenon
Nachrichten: 36
Anmeldung: 2. Juni 2016 - 8:04 Uhr

20. März 2018 - 10:36 Uhr

Toll!
...
{'computer_fqdn': u'nadm-016.domain.int', 'uuid': u'C6125DD3-B738-11E6-9C43-BC0000580000'}

Großartig, das ist fantastisch! Ich kann alle PCs wieder in WaptConsole sehen!!!

Nun bleibt das zweite Problem bestehen... Ich kann mich nicht zwischen Update und Upgrade entscheiden.
wapt1.5.jpg
wapt1.5.jpg (127,21 KB) 7822 Mal angesehen
Benutzeravatar
agauvrit
WAPT-Experte
Nachrichten: 238
Anmeldung: 17. November 2016 - 10:25 Uhr
Ort: Nantes
Kontakt:

20. März 2018 - 10:42 Uhr

Zwei Hypothesen:
  • Ihre Beiträge erscheinen nicht pünktlich.
  • Ihr Server ist nicht pünktlich.
Alexander
Stenon
Nachrichten: 36
Anmeldung: 2. Juni 2016 - 8:04 Uhr

20. März 2018 - 11:04 Uhr

Danke für den Hinweis; es waren tatsächlich 10 Minuten Unterschied. Ich habe es korrigiert, aber das Problem besteht weiterhin.
wapt1.5-2.jpg
wapt1.5-2.jpg (25,78 KB) 7821 Mal angesehen
Muss ich nachbestellen?

PS: Ich habe auch den Wapt-Server neu gestartet.
Benutzeravatar
Sfonteneau
WAPT-Experte
Nachrichten: 2322
Registriert: 10. Juli 2014 - 23:52 Uhr
Kontakt:

20. März 2018 - 11:37 Uhr

Der Import funktioniert,

der Server ist pünktlich.

Folgen Sie nun den weiteren Anweisungen unter:

https://www.wapt.fr/fr/doc/waptserver_u ... grade.html
Gesperrt